## StockSync Environments

StockSync runs the nightly inventory reconciliation for Marrowfield retail sites. Plugins may target dev or staging only; production jobs reject unsigned plugin bundles. Dev uses synthetic stock deltas. Staging replays the previous night's real deltas with writes disabled. Reconciliation windows, batch sizes, and mismatch tolerances differ per environment. Do not hardcode these. The staging environment's current configuration is as follows.

config for kafof-bawef:
holath:
  log_level: debug
  metrics_host: metrics.holath.qorvelsys.internal
  pin: 2191
  pool_size: 32

## Bloom filter tier (Hollowcache)

Support notes: the bloom filter sits in front of the Hollowcache KV store and answers definite-miss lookups. False positives are expected (~1%); they just cause a harmless backing-store read. Never restart the filter without warming it — cold starts send full traffic downstream for ~15 minutes. Rebuilds run nightly. The filter process starts with the parameters listed below.

service settings:
[casax]
port = 6379
team = rusir
host = casax.zemvarhq.corp
region = outer-4
access_code = ac_9808ce
timeout_ms = 1500

Single customer, Brellan Consolidated, now represents 46% of revenue, up from 31% two years ago. Contract renewal is ten months out. Pricing leverage is eroding; last renewal conceded 6% on unit price. Loss scenario: EBITDA down roughly a third, covenant pressure within two quarters. Mitigation underway: two mid-market prospects in late-stage trials, capacity reallocation plan drafted. Finance should stress-test receivables exposure this month. The proposed diversification plan is summarized below.

confidential, hahop-bajep: Gross margin on Ralath came in at 5 percent against a plan of 10 percent. Only 9 of the 100 pilot accounts renewed Ralath, so a churn review is set for April 1.